What you shared in this post is a phenomena, a method, an experience we all have in common from the very earliest days of our lives.  Yet few of us ever stop to consider the impact it had on us or think about how we might use the valuable lessons it teaches.

This process is so effective that virtually everyone who uses it succeeds mightily.

What am I talking about? The experience of learning how to walk.  

While our parents, relatives and friends didn&#039;t have a written blue print -- an excellent recommendation by the way for the things we want to teach young people and adults alike -- they did provide us with plenty of immediate, consistent, repetitive and positive feedback  . . .

*The first time we rolled over
*The first time we crawled
*The first time we held on to something and pulled ourselves up off the floor
*The first time we took a step
*The first time we put a few steps together
*The first time we walked without the help of anything at all
*The first time we ran

We didn&#039;t shrink from fear because we knew we were surrounded by people who loved us, cared about us and would protect us.

We learned by watching, by imitating and by taking someone&#039;s hand as they helped us acquire the skills that we were born to master.

If we apply the same kind of thinking and caring to helping people with all the &quot;firsts&quot; they&#039;re going to experience as they build their business, chances are they&#039;ll have the same kind of success they had with walking.
